They are descendants from old Lithuanian [[Astikai]] family, that had possessions near [[Kernavė]]. Radziwiłł family's known ancestor has been a Lithuanian noble [[Radvila Astikas]]. His father [[Kristinas Astikas]] was the first to receive [[Trąby Coat of Arms]] after the [[Union of Horodlo]] in [[1413]], which became the coat of arms of the family. The first person to use [[Radvila]] as a family name was a son of [[Radvila Astikas]], [[Mikalojus Radvila]], whose sons became the progenitors of the three known Radziwiłł family lines. In [[Polish language|Polish]], the name has been spelled ''Radziwiłł'' now for several centuries, but it originally comes from the Lithuanian name, spelled in {{lang-lt|Radvila}}, plural ''Radvilos''. The name is spelled in {{lang-be|Радзівіл, Radzivił}} (plural ''Радзівілы'', ''Radziviły''). The Radziwiłł family kept its importance and [[szlachta]]rial status for over five centuries. They acquired and maintained great wealth and influence from [[15th century]]-[[16th century]] until the beginning of [[Second World War]] in [[1939]]. The family has produced many outstanding politicians, military commanders, clergymen, cultural benefactors and entrepreneurs who left a significant mark on [[history of Poland|Polish]], [[history of Belarus|Belarusian]], [[history of Lithuania|Lithuanian]] and European history and culture. A branch of Radvila Astikas' descendants became powerful [[magnates]] and their name is remembered as one of the most famous [[magnate]] families in [[Grand Duchy of Lithuania]] (later, the [[Polish-Lithuanian Commonwealth]]). The Radziwiłł family reached the heights of its importance and power during the [[Polish Golden Age|Golden Age]] of the [[Polish-Lithuanian Commonwealth]] in the [[16th century]]. Lithuanian Radziwiłłs were elevated to the title of ''Reichsfürst'' (Prince of the Empire), granted by [[Maximilian I, Holy Roman Emperor]] after the [[First Congress of Vienna|Jagiellonian-Habsburg congress]] at [[Vienna]] in [[1515]]. This title was very unusual among [[szlachta]] (Polish-Lithuanian nobility). The main seat of [[Biržai]]-[[Dubingiai]] Radziwiłł family line was [[Dubingiai Castle]] and since the second half of the 17th century - [[Biržai Castle]] (both in [[Lithuania]]). This line became extinct after the death of [[Ludwika Karolina Radziwiłł]] in 1695. Since the 18th century all Radziwiłłs are descendants of the Nieśwież-Ołyka Radziwiłł family line, which had its main residence at [[Niasvizh Castle]] (Nieśwież) in present-day [[Belarus]]. Other residences and properties included [[Mir Castle]], [[Ołyka]], [[Biržai]], [[Kėdainiai]], [[Szydłowiec]], [[Taujėnai]], [[Połoneczka]] and [[Radziwiłłów]].
